New Book on 596th Airborne Engineers

The new book is here! I was contacted a while back by someone writing a book on the World War II 596th Airborne Engineers. My Grandpa Anderson was a part of this unit and in working with the author I shared a couple of photos and stories with him. Grandpa is actually featured a couple of times in the book. How exciting is that! I haven’t read the whole book yet, but I have looked through the photos and there are at least two photos included, with one that mentions Grandpa’s Bronze Star medal.

For anyone interested in learning about paratrooper in WWII there are two good books here: https://1stabtf.com/en/home/

The 517’s Gang is the first book and is about the larger company, while Aly Daly and his 140 Thieves is specific to the 596th Airborne Engineer Company.
